Actor Sidharth Malhotra has not yet officially announced his next film but the rumour has it that he might have signed Aankhen 2 which is a sequel to the 2002 thriller drama, Aankhen.

Sidharth Malhotra may not have delivered profitable box office releases but the actor is still among the favourites of youth and has films on his platter. His upcoming film Shershaah is with rumoured girlfriend Kiara Advani with whom he spent New Year in the Maldives. On Monday, Sidharth even dropped a hint suggesting that he may be doing the film.

Taking to Instagram, the actor shared a video in which he shot himself and kept the focus on his eyes. Using a filter to get grey coloured eyes, the actor played around as he used Jay Sean’s song ‘Eyes On You’ to make his brief video dramatic. Seems like the post was a confirmation from Sidharth who might have signed the dotted line to play one of the visually challenged men, according to reports.

The sequel will have a new cast and script with Amitabh Bachchan being retained. Meanwhile, the second visually challenged man will most likely be played by Akshaye Khanna. Aankhen 2 will be helmed by Delhi Belly director Abhinay Deo and produced by Tarun Agarwal of Rajtaru Studios in association with Eros international. Aankhen‘s original producer Gaurang Doshi is not associated with the film. The 2002 thriller drama was a big hit and featured Amitabh Bachchan, Akshay Kumar, Paresh Rawal, Arjun Rampal and Sushmita Sen in the key roles.
